干旱区滴灌核桃树根系空间分布特性研究

摘    要:为了研究核桃树根系空间分布特性,本文使用分层分段挖掘法对干旱区滴灌方式下核桃树根系总根长、根重、有效吸收根根长的空间分布规律进行了研究。研究表明:核桃树根系总根长水平方向主要分布在0~120cm处,占其总分布的90.84%;垂直方向主要分布在0~90cm处,占其总分布的78.75%。根重水平方向主要分布在0~30cm处,占其总分布的52.49%;垂直方向主要分布在15~75em处,占其总分布的61.12%。有效吸水根根长在水平距离60cm和垂直深度60cm处为分布密集区。在距离树干水平距离60cm和垂直深度60cm附近的根区,应作为核桃树水肥管理的重点区域。

Study on characteristic of root distribution of walnut tree under condition of drip irrigation in arid area

Abstract:In order to study the spatial distribution feature of walnut tree root, this article used the layered sublevel mining method to study the total root length walnut tree, root weight, effective absorption root and the rule of spatial distribution under the mode of drip irrigation in arid areas. The research has shown that trees roots at horizontal direction are mainly distributed in 0 -120 cm, accounted for 90.84% of the total distribution; Vertical direction are mainly distributed in 0 -90 cm, accounted for 78.75% of the total distribution. Root weight at horizontal direction are mainly distributed in 0 to 30 em, accounted for 52.49% of the total distribution; tree roots at vertical direction are mainly distributed in 15 -75 cm, accounted for 61.12% of the total distribution. Effective root length of suction is the distribution areas of concentration of 60 cm at horizontal direction and 60 em at vertical direction . The root zone at 60 cm horizontal distance and vertical depth of 60 cm from trunk should be taken as the key area of water and fertilizer management of walnut tree.
